A Little Discipline Goes a Long Way

It all started last summer when the girls each opened up their own bank accounts.
It was agreed that a certain amount from each weeks allowance would be set aside as
savings.  "What can we spend it on?" was the question often asked.  We will have to see, was
always the answer.






 This past January, Kerrington and Ireland started talking of purchasing
new digital cameras, so when they asked if the savings could be spent on that they got a different
answer,"Yes, of course!"  (happy screams, excited laughter and  a little bit of jumping up and down followed)  They had approximately half the amount saved up, so the hunt for a cool camera and hot deal was now their pursuit.
Costco had some really nice cameras, so they each decided on the one they wanted.  With this tangible goal now in front them they ramped up their savings by now including their weekly spending money to their growing fund. Things really started to add up much more quickly and so did their determination and excitement.  Saying no to themselves, especially at the dollar store was a great lesson in self discipline.

Last Saturday we had to go to Costco for a few items, and now it had almost become a tradition to stop by the camera display, we looked at their chosen beauties, and to our great surprise the camera Kerrington had chosen had dropped in price by $30.00 but the camera Ireland had chosen had gone up $30.00.
Alot of excitement from one and a pretty disappointed look from another. So some talking and deciding
resulted in a minor chose adjustment for Ireland, she went with the same camera as Kerrington but in the blue. The reason she had chosen the other camera originally was because it came with two SD cards for the camera, but it no longer was worth the extra cost. I don't think I've shopped Costco quite so quickly before, I couldn't help myself I was very excited for them to "finally" get the reward they
had worked so hard for and deserved.
Their initial goal was to have the money saved up by June, but we are all so excited to say they had enough money to purchase their new cameras on March 12.  That is pretty awesome.
So for a job well done we purchased K and I each a 4GB SD card, so now they are all set to take as many pictures as they want and they still have money in their savings account.
